How to avoid hidden costs on cheap VPS?
Check stability and incident frequency, not only headline monthly pricing.
When should I upgrade from an entry plan?
Upgrade when sustained load creates response instability that affects user experience.
Can budget VPS run production workloads?
Yes, when baseline latency, uptime, and network consistency remain predictable.
What should I prioritize for MVP hosting?
Cost-to-performance balance with a clear upgrade path is usually the best start.
Do low prices always mean poor quality?
Not always, but low-price plans should always be validated with practical checks.
Which metric is most useful for budget decisions?
Response consistency under normal load is often the most actionable metric.

About VPSEconom
VPSEconom targets teams that must optimize hosting cost without sacrificing operational stability. It is particularly useful for startups and lean product groups where infrastructure expenses must remain controlled while user-facing performance remains acceptable.
The analysis model is tuned for budget decision-making: identifying plans that are affordable yet predictable, flagging options with strong short-term pricing but weak long-term reliability, and showing where minor cost increases can materially reduce incident risk.
Instead of treating cheap hosting as automatically good or bad, VPSEconom emphasizes evidence-based trade-offs. Teams can understand where low-cost nodes are viable for production, where variability becomes dangerous, and when upgrades should be triggered by observable service behavior.
This perspective is valuable during the transition from prototype to recurring traffic. It supports planning for controlled scaling, avoiding forced emergency migrations, and aligning infrastructure choices with product milestones and service commitments.
